The majority of A-to-I RNA editing is not required for mammalian homeostasis
RNAseq of Adult Brain in ADAR1 E861A, ADAR2 knock out, ADAR1 E861A x ADAR2 knock out het, and ADAR1 E861A x ADAR2 knock out mice generated by deep sequencing.
